Slim Jim
Slim Jim Slim Jim can be used to unlock doors of cars without a key. It's a metal strip with a hook on one end and a bend on the other. It can be put between the window and the weatherstripping in the car to bypass the security features that are mechanically built into the car door. Then it can be moved to grasp the linkage which opens the car door by pressing or squeezing the unlock button, or by lifting and grabbing the door handle.
Slim Jims are employed by professional locksmiths to assist motorists gain access to their cars when they accidentally lock the keys inside. They might also suggest using a coathanger to unlock the manual lock. But, this is a risky option and requires careful handling. It can cause damage to the vehicle's windows, interior and locking mechanisms if not handled properly.

Locksmiths in Scottsdale usually start with the passenger side of the car when using a Slim Jim. This means that if the process damages the lock rods, they will not affect the safety of the driver. Unexperienced drivers will often remove rods for locking and leave the door unoperable, even with keys. Modern car models are equipped with internal security measures that stop the use of these tools. These defenses could include barrier blocks in the windows' bottom to prevent forced entry attempts, or shrouding of operating rods and locking cylinders that stop the manipulation of internal links.

It is sometimes difficult to figure out the issue with an ignition. It may be stuck on the ON or accessory positions, or it may not even turn. A locksmith can examine the switch for damaged wiring, bad contacts or damaged parts, and then fix it. They can also repair or replace the steering column or the ignition cylinder if needed.
